I believe for both systems the hinges with out the re-enforcement are rated for 33s. Add the reinforcement for 35s.Exogate states it hold up to a 35 inch tire Where Moryde states that it only holds up to a 33 inch tire.
200 in/lbs is about 17 ft/lbs. Don't be scared of it.Do you guys torque the bolts back to factory specs? Worried about stripping threads on the nut plate at 200 in/lbs on the tailgate side, and the tub side on the lower hinge.

I have a tip that will make your life a lot better when installing your kit. Take a piece of cardboard and put it under the tailgate on the hinge side to keep the gap even. This will help with aligning and installing all the bolts.I just got the MORryde Exogate delivered yesterday and waiting on delivery of a stock tire carrier to finish the install.
